Maria Cecilia dreams of having the spiciest Mexican Quinceañera possible… in Durham, North Carolina. Coming from an old fashioned Mexican family, y con una hermana mayor que festejó sus quinces en México, they have certain traditions that they want to uphold. But Maria is determined to get things done her way!
In Monday's episode of "Quiero Mis Quinces," Maria y su familia visit their homeland every Summer, cook traditional meals, and listen to Mexican music that keeps their roots close to their hearts. Even if her family thinks she’s weird because she enjoys reading books and is strictly vegetarian, Maria’s very close to them and her herencia mexicana. But she also values her bi-cultural lifestyle, and wants to bring both worlds together at her fiesta de quinces.

Every quinceañera wants her big day to be all about her. And how will Maria keep all eyes focused on the big day? Well, by being the only dama in her court, of course! According to Maria, “too many damas bring too much drama.” Instead, she gathers nine chambelanes to be her escorts. Yes, that’s right, nueve!
Para su gran fiesta, Maria wants to celebrate with a rose garden theme, which means having the perfect bright pink dress para que ella sea la rosa más bella. She orders a dress from a catalog and has it brought to the house, but when she tries it on, her parents disapprove on the low cut that shows a bit too much cleavage.
Maria is set on this being the one, so she compromises by asking for the dress to be mended para que sea mas apropriado and covers more of her goodies. With a few bats of the lashes, and big puppy eyes, su papá no puede resistir, and Maria gets her dream dress.
El dia de su cumpleaños, Maria’s family surprises her with a traditional mariachi band, cantandole las mañanitas right outside her window! Que buena manera de despartar, no? This was the perfect start to her big day, putting her in the right mood to get her party on!
And trust us, Maria can party! She goes through cuatro vestuarios diferentes throughout the night,
ranging from simple to dazzling, but each costume looks beautiful on the birthday girl who spent most of the time on the dancefloor. She dances with her papi and waltzes with all of her nine escorts, then changes to delight her guests with a special performance.
The duranguense bands are also a big hit, and get everyone dancing along with Maria, hasta los
invitados norteamericanos. So it looks like even though Maria wasn’t able to have her quinces in
México like her sister, she was able to bring some of México to North Carolina. Bien hecho Maria!
